What will you be doing
Responsible for day-to-day operations of the Community Day Services program and for assuring compliance with all applicable DHS DPH CARF and local rules and standards and agency policies and procedures. Supervise assigned staff and provide clients and staff members with a team oriented positive professional and safe environment to learn and safety staffing and client documentation in accordance with all applicable state local and agency standards and all applicable documentation records and reports related to provided services and supports and functions as a member of the Interdisciplinary input and information to the IDT as needed and functions as a QIDP if assigned developing and implementing individual programs and maintaining documentation and records as required.
Job Responsibilities:
Program Responsibilities
- Assure program compliance to all rules regulations and recommendations per program state and federal guidelines including AID procedures and applicable DHS IDPH CARF HCBS and Medicaid Waiver/CMS rules
- Provide input on program philosophies policies and procedures in accordance with current knowledge and expertise in the field
- Ensure the provision of appropriate functional and stimulating programming for clients in activities of daily living health promotion work and participation in the community
- Maintain program materials and update as needed based upon client needs/abilities
- Create and maintain all required electronic and/or hard copies of program records such as personnel information client information communication logs external and internal monitoring reports and audits safety documentation and staff/client/committee meeting minutes
- Submit and assure timely and accurate paperwork for billing incident/accident reports and client input meetings and staff meetings
- Review and assist to update program procedures as requested
Complete following trainings:
o DSP within 120 days of hire (if needed)
o QIDP Orientation Curriculum within 6 months of hire
o Maintain current certification in CPR and FA
o Maintain current certification in CPI
o OIG Rule 50 annually
o HIPAA Infection Control and Hazard Communication annually
o Other trainings as assigned
o Complete QIDP 12 CEUs annually following QIDP training
- Monitor and assist program to ensure compliance with financial and HR policies and procedures regarding purchases and budgets
- Assist to oversee maintenance repair inspections and corrections of facility/grounds/vehicle and housekeeping to assure a safe environment
- Work to continuously improve relationships with AID stakeholders referral sources and providers of support services
Staff/Supervising Responsibilities
- Supervise DSPs and CDS Instructors to assure client programming documentation safety rights confidentiality and compliance with agency state and federal regulations
- Facilitate teamwork and positive interactions & attitudes among staff
- Recruit interview and hire staff according to AID policies and procedures including seeking input from staff and clients
- Orient all staff to job program and agency and provide on-going training per procedures
- Develop coverage schedules input schedules into When 2 Work program and supervise and monitor staff schedules ensuring compliance with relevant labor laws and AID procedures
- Complete staff performance evaluations at 60 days after hire per AID procedures
- Monitor and approve staff time cards and PTO on a weekly basis through payroll management system (Paycom)
- Provide regular communication to staff and facilitate effective meetings and in-service trainings as required
- Ensure staff and clients are trained in safety requirements and AID procedures regarding safety.
Responsibility to Clients
- Manage a caseload of clients per AID and regulatory standards if assigned
- If assigned a caseload organize and conduct annual planning meetings and other meetings for clients as necessary to meet agency and program rules and regulations
- Provide training guidance and monitoring to staff to assure proper implementation of all clients Implementation Strategies and/or Behavior Support strategies as needed
- Develop and provide instruction/training to clients as defined in the clients Implementation Strategy or Individual Plan to enhance and build skills including in areas of health promotion and community integration
- Actively support the clients needs for adaptive equipment and assistive technology through assessment seeking resources and implementation
Additional Job Responsibilities:
- Represent CDS programs or agency on internal and external committees as requested
- Organize prioritize and respond with flexibility and objectivity to meet the requirements of the job and the challenges of growth
- Perform other job-related tasks as assigned
